Early Methods: The Roots of Meal Planning

In prehistoric times, meal planning was instinctive and driven by necessity. Early humans relied on observation, seasonal availability, and immediate needs to decide what to hunt, gather, or store. There was no formal system; instead, survival dictated the rhythm of eating and resource management. As societies developed, so did their methods of meal planning.

Ancient civilizations, such as the Egyptians, Greeks, and Romans, began to document recipes, cooking techniques, and sometimes meal schedules. These records were often preserved in texts and inscriptions, highlighting a growing appreciation for organized food preparation. However, even with these advancements, meal planning remained largely manual—dependent on individual memory, tradition, and the availability of ingredients.

The Age of Household Cookbooks and Meal Calendars

Fast forward to the 18th and 19th centuries, where the publication of cookbooks and household guides transformed home cooking. These resources provided families with structured meal ideas, shopping lists, and schedules—albeit still relying heavily on human effort and decision-making. Housewives and cooks used these books to plan weekly menus, often based on seasonal produce and local markets.

This era marked the beginning of systematic meal planning, but it remained time-consuming. Households had to manually create shopping lists, juggle dietary preferences, and remember what was cooked previously. Despite these efforts, decision fatigue was common, especially when juggling multiple dietary restrictions or trying to maintain variety.

The Industrial Revolution and Convenience

The advent of the Industrial Revolution introduced processed foods, canned goods, and later, refrigeration. These innovations simplified grocery shopping and meal preparation but did little to automate planning itself. Instead, they shifted focus toward convenience—frozen meals, pre-packaged ingredients, and meal kits.

While these innovations made cooking faster, they did not address the complexity of planning nutritious, balanced, and sustainable meals. Consumers still faced the challenge of deciding what to eat, balancing health goals with taste preferences, and minimizing food waste.

The Digital Dawn: From Paper to Pixels

The late 20th century brought computers into homes, opening new horizons for meal planning. Early digital tools included simple spreadsheets and databases to store recipes or track dietary intake. As personal technology advanced, so did the sophistication of meal planning aids.

The rise of the internet facilitated access to countless recipes and nutrition information. However, the abundance of choices often led to decision fatigue—the overwhelming feeling of having too many options and not knowing which to select. This paradox of choice became a barrier for many trying to adopt healthier habits or reduce food waste.

The Connection Between Food and Environmental Sustainability

Food production is one of the most resource-intensive activities globally. It accounts for approximately 26% of global greenhouse gas emissions (GHGs), according to the United Nations Food and Agriculture Organization (FAO). From deforestation for farmland, water consumption, energy use in processing, to transportation emissions, the environmental footprint of our diets is substantial.

However, individual choices—what to buy, how much to prepare, and how to manage leftovers—can collectively make a significant difference. Smarter meal choices help mitigate these impacts by:

  • Reducing food waste
  • Optimizing resource use
  • Encouraging plant-based diets
  • Supporting local and seasonal eating

How Strategic Meal Planning Reduces Food Waste

Food waste is a pressing global issue—about one-third of all food produced is wasted, which not only represents a squandered resource but also contributes to methane emissions from decomposing food in landfills. Strategic meal planning addresses this problem head-on.

Precise Shopping and Portion Control

Smart meal planning tools enable users to generate automatic grocery lists based on planned meals. These lists help shoppers buy only what they need, avoiding impulse purchases and overbuying. For example, when a meal plan includes exactly the right amount of ingredients, there's less temptation—and less waste—due to excess.

Leftover Management and Meal Tracking

Features like meal tracking and recipe history allow users to identify which ingredients or dishes they tend to forget or overprepare. Recognizing patterns helps in adjusting future plans to prevent leftovers from spoiling. Additionally, some apps facilitate meal prep by suggesting recipes that utilize ingredients nearing their expiration dates, further reducing waste.

Encouraging Reuse and Repurposing

Smart apps can suggest creative ways to reuse leftovers or adapt recipes based on what’s available, fostering a mindset of resourcefulness. This behavioral shift not only minimizes waste but also cultivates a more mindful approach to cooking.


Lowering Carbon Footprints Through Thoughtful Choices

The carbon footprint of a meal depends heavily on the type of ingredients and their journey from farm to table. Meat-heavy diets, especially those centered on beef and lamb, have significantly higher GHG emissions compared to plant-based diets.

Promoting Plant-Centric Eating
